Meanwhile, in a large bowl, mix together the oil and sugar. Gradually beat in the egg, along with the reserved water from the raisins, the cinnamon and vanilla extract. Sift the flour, bicarbonate of soda and a pinch of salt into the bowl, then add the oats.

They're made with old-fashioned oats, brown sugar, and plenty of raisins. In a large bowl, cream the shortening and sugars until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ition. In large bowl, beat all ingredients except oats, flour and raisins with electric mixer on medium speed, or mix with spoon.
